New hope for rare leukemia: drug targets MEK gene in BRAF-Negative patients
NCT ID NCT04322383
First seen Apr 08, 2026 · Last updated Jun 18, 2026 · Updated 16 times
Summary
This study tests a drug called binimetinib for people with hairy cell leukemia that does not have the common BRAF gene mutation. The drug targets a different gene, MEK, which is often altered in these patients. The goal is to see if it can shrink or control the cancer in 40 adults whose disease has returned or not responded to prior treatments.
